The Importance of This Topic

Zero Target Printable, a relatively new concept gaining traction in specialized fields, refers to the process of creating printable targets with a precise zero point at the center. This precise zero point acts as a reference for various measurements and calibrations, eliminating guesswork and reducing error margins. Its relevance extends across numerous industries, from ballistics and engineering to scientific research and even specialized hobbyist applications like archery and precision shooting. Further Exploration: Delving Deeper into "Accuracy"

Accuracy, in the context of Zero Target Printable, hinges on several factors:

Factor Description
Printing Precision The accuracy of the printing technology directly influences the zero point's precision.
Material Stability The chosen material's dimensional stability under various conditions affects accuracy.
Environmental Factors Temperature, humidity, and light can influence the accuracy of measurements.

FAQ Section: Answering Common Questions About Zero Target Printable

  1. Q: What types of printers can be used to create Zero Target Printables? A: Various printers can be used, including inkjet, laser, and even 3D printers depending on the desired material and complexity.

  2. Q: What materials are suitable for creating Zero Target Printables? A: Materials should be chosen based on the specific application, but durable options like cardstock, vinyl, or specialized polymer materials are often preferred.

  3. Q: How can I ensure the accuracy of my Zero Target Printable? A: Use a high-quality printer, calibrate it properly, and use stable, dimensionally accurate materials. Control environmental factors during printing and use.

  4. Q: Are there specific software programs for designing Zero Target Printables? A: While specialized software isn't strictly necessary, design software like Adobe Illustrator or similar programs can aid in creating precise designs.

  5. Q: What are the limitations of Zero Target Printables? A: Accuracy is limited by the printer's precision, material properties, and environmental conditions.

  6. Q: Where can I find pre-made Zero Target Printables? A: Online retailers specializing in shooting supplies or precision measurement tools might offer pre-made options.

Practical Strategies for Maximizing the Value of Zero Target Printable

  1. Choose the Right Printer: Select a printer with high print resolution and accuracy.
  2. Use Durable Materials: Opt for materials resistant to wear and tear, maintaining accuracy over time.
  3. Calibrate Regularly: Ensure the printer is consistently calibrated for optimal performance.
  4. Control Environmental Factors: Maintain a stable environment during printing and use to minimize variations.
  5. Design for Clarity: Create designs with clear, easily readable markings.
  6. Implement Quality Control: Regularly inspect the printed targets to ensure accuracy and identify any discrepancies.
  7. Store Properly: Protect the printed targets from damage and environmental factors.
